Rage: Bulgarian journalist Viktoria Marinova—who had been reporting on fraud allegations between the European Union and private corporations—was found raped and murdered over the weekend.
Rewind: This week, Romanian voters will decide whether or not the country should change the definition of marriage in its constitution from "between spouses" to "between a man and a woman."
Girl With Balloon: A famous piece of Banksy art self-destructed Saturday after being auctioned off.
No Survivors: A limo headed to a birthday celebration in upstate New York spun out in an intersection over the weekend—killing all 18 occupants and two pedestrians. It's the country's deadliest car crash in 9 years.

Disrupting the Peace: A person drove a silver Lexus through a group of marchers protesting the recent shooting death of 27-year-old Patrick Kimmons by Portland police. According to KATU, neither the protesters hit by the car or driver had contacted the police as of last night. Here's a video the news channel took of the incident:

More Katt News: Comedian Katt Williams was arrested in Portland Saturday after allegedly assaulting a hired town car driver over an argument involving Williams' dog. It's the latest in a remarkably long list of assaults on Williams' rap sheet.
